What is the typical cost of cocaine addiction treatment and other addiction treatments in Costa Rica?
The cost of cocaine addiction treatment and other addiction treatments in Costa Rica typically ranges from $8,000 to $25,000 USD per month. This price can vary significantly based on the program's intensity, duration, and the amenities provided by the treatment center.
Understanding the financial aspect of seeking help for addiction is a crucial first step. Costa Rica has emerged as a popular destination for medical tourism, including addiction recovery, largely due to its blend of high-quality care and often more affordable pricing compared to countries like the United States or Canada. For instance, a basic 30-day program might be on the lower end of the spectrum, while a comprehensive, personalized program with luxury accommodations and a wide array of holistic therapies could approach the higher end.
Factors that influence this cost range include:
- Program Type: Inpatient residential programs are generally more expensive than outpatient options due to the inclusion of accommodation, meals, and 24/7 supervision.
- Duration of Stay: Longer treatment periods naturally incur higher total costs, though the daily rate might be more economical in extended programs.
- Included Services: The extent of therapies, medical supervision, and holistic activities bundled into the package.
- Facility Amenities: Luxury centers with private rooms, gourmet meals, and extensive recreational facilities will command higher prices than more standard, modest environments.
- Staff-to-Patient Ratio: Programs with a higher staff-to-patient ratio offering more personalized attention tend to be more expensive.
It's always recommended to get a clear breakdown of what's included in any quoted price to avoid surprises.
What services are usually included in the overall cost of addiction treatment programs in Costa Rica?
Typically, the overall cost of addiction treatment programs in Costa Rica covers a comprehensive suite of services including medical detoxification, individual and group therapy, counseling, accommodation, meals, and various holistic activities. Some premium programs might also include specialized therapies like equine therapy or adventure activities.
When you invest in an addiction treatment program, especially an inpatient one, you're usually paying for a holistic approach to recovery. Here’s a breakdown of common inclusions:
- Detoxification: Medically supervised detox is often the first step, ensuring a safe and comfortable withdrawal process. This typically involves medical assessments, medication management, and round-the-clock nursing care.
- Therapy Sessions: Core to any program are individual counseling with licensed therapists, group therapy sessions for peer support, and family therapy where appropriate.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), and Motivational Interviewing are common modalities.
- Accommodation and Meals: For residential programs, this includes comfortable living spaces and nutritious, often chef-prepared, meals designed to support physical recovery.
- Holistic and Wellness Activities: Many centers in Costa Rica emphasize holistic healing. This can include yoga, meditation, mindfulness practices, fitness programs, art therapy, nature walks, and even adventure tourism elements leveraging Costa Rica's natural beauty.
- Medical and Psychiatric Support: Regular check-ups, psychiatric evaluations, and medication management are usually provided by on-site medical professionals.
- Aftercare Planning: A crucial component is the development of a personalized aftercare plan to support long-term sobriety once you leave the facility.
It's important to confirm the exact inclusions with each center, as offerings can differ.

Can I use my health insurance to cover addiction treatment costs in Costa Rica?
Generally, most international health insurance policies do not cover addiction treatment abroad, including in Costa Rica. It's crucial to contact your specific insurance provider to understand your policy's limitations for international medical services. Most patients fund their treatment through self-pay options.
Navigating insurance coverage for international treatment can be complex. While some premium international health insurance plans might offer limited coverage for specific medical procedures abroad, comprehensive addiction treatment is rarely fully covered. Here's what you should consider:
- Policy Review: Always review your insurance policy's "out-of-network" and "international coverage" clauses. Many policies specifically exclude mental health and substance abuse treatment received outside your home country.
- Pre-authorization: Even if there is some potential for coverage, you will almost certainly need to seek pre-authorization from your insurer before traveling for treatment.
- Reimbursement Basis: If any coverage is available, it's typically on a reimbursement basis, meaning you pay upfront and then submit claims for partial repayment.
- In-Network Limitations: Your insurance company likely has a network of approved providers within your home country. Treatment centers in Costa Rica would generally fall outside this network.
Because of these challenges, most individuals pursuing addiction treatment in Costa Rica plan for self-payment, often viewing it as a direct investment in their health and future.
Are there any hidden or unexpected costs I should be aware of when planning addiction treatment in Costa Rica?
While many centers offer all-inclusive packages, potential hidden costs might include travel expenses (flights, airport transfers), personal spending money, prescription medications not covered by the program, additional specialized therapies outside the standard package, and any necessary pre- or post-treatment medical consultations.
Budgeting for addiction treatment means looking beyond the sticker price of the program itself. To avoid surprises, here are some areas where unexpected costs can arise:
- Travel Logistics: This is often the largest "hidden" cost. Flights to Costa Rica, visas (if applicable), and ground transportation to and from the treatment center should be factored in. Some centers might offer airport pickup, but confirm if it's included in the package.
- Personal Expenses: While most daily needs are covered, you might want money for souvenirs, snacks, phone calls, or personal items not provided by the center.
- Medications: While detox medications are usually included, any ongoing prescriptions for co-occurring mental health conditions or other health issues might be an additional charge if not explicitly stated in the package.
- Specialized Add-ons: If you opt for additional therapies like advanced psychological evaluations, specialized dental work, or specific alternative therapies not part of the core program, these will typically incur extra fees.
- Aftercare Support: While discharge planning is included, ongoing therapy, support groups, or sober living arrangements post-treatment will be additional costs you need to plan for.
- Exchange Rates/Bank Fees: Be mindful of currency exchange rates and potential international transaction fees from your bank when making payments.
Always ask for a detailed list of what is and isn't included when inquiring about treatment costs.
How does the duration of addiction treatment impact its cost in Costa Rica?
The duration of treatment directly influences the total cost. Shorter programs (e.g., 30 days) will be less expensive overall than longer programs (e.g., 60 or 90 days). However, longer programs often provide better long-term recovery outcomes and might offer a lower daily rate, providing better value for extended care.
When considering addiction treatment, the length of stay is a critical factor both therapeutically and financially. Most programs are structured around common durations:
- 30-Day Programs: These are often the entry-level option, providing an intensive initial period of detox and therapy. While they have the lowest total cost, they might be insufficient for individuals with severe or long-standing addictions, potentially leading to a higher risk of relapse.
- 60-Day Programs: Offering a more substantial period for healing, these programs allow for deeper engagement with therapeutic work, skill-building, and addressing underlying issues. The total cost is higher than 30-day programs, but they can provide a more robust foundation for lasting sobriety.
- 90-Day or Extended Programs: These are often recommended for chronic addiction, multiple relapses, or co-occurring disorders. The total cost is highest, but the extended time allows for profound personal growth, solidifying coping mechanisms, and planning for reintegration into daily life. Often, the daily rate for these longer stays is more economical than for shorter programs.
While a shorter program might seem more attractive financially upfront, a longer, more comprehensive program can often provide better long-term results, potentially saving money and distress in the future by reducing the likelihood of relapse and the need for subsequent treatments.

What factors contribute to the variation in pricing for addiction treatment centers in Costa Rica?
Several factors drive price variations, including the center's accreditation and reputation, the qualifications and experience of the medical and therapeutic staff, the quality and luxury of the facilities, the intensity and personalization of the treatment program, and the specific geographic location within Costa Rica.
It’s helpful to understand why one treatment center might charge significantly more than another. Here are key contributors to price differences:
- Accreditation and Licensing: Centers holding international accreditations (e.g., Joint Commission International - JCI) or local governmental licenses often command higher prices due to their adherence to rigorous quality and safety standards.
- Staff Expertise: The qualifications, experience, and specialization of the clinical team (doctors, psychiatrists, therapists, nurses) play a huge role. Centers with highly credentialed, internationally trained professionals will reflect this in their pricing.
- Facility Type and Amenities: As mentioned, luxury resorts offering spa services, private villas, and gourmet dining will be at the top end. More modest, yet still effective, centers will be more affordable. The physical environment greatly influences cost.
- Program Customization: Highly individualized treatment plans with one-on-one therapy sessions and specialized interventions are more resource-intensive than more standardized group-based programs.
- Location: Centers located in prime tourist areas or with direct access to natural attractions might have higher operational costs, which are passed on to patients. Those in more secluded, rural areas might be more affordable.
- Clientele Focus: Some centers cater to specific populations, such as high-net-worth individuals or professionals, offering more exclusive services that come with a premium price tag.
Always consider what factors are most important for your recovery journey when evaluating costs.
